Sec. 562.159. MODIFICATION OR SETTING ASIDE OF ORDER. On the notice and in the manner the department determines proper, the department may modify or set aside wholly or partly a cease and desist order issued under Section 562.158 at any time before a petition appealing the order is filed in accordance with Subchapter D , Chapter 36 .

Legislative History
Added by Acts 2009, 81st Leg., R.S., Ch. 1331 (H.B. 4341 ), Sec. 1, eff. September 1, 2009.
